
NSW Health has confirmed two new coronavirus deaths in NSW, taking Australia's total number of fatalities to 74.
The state's chief health officer Kerry Chant said a 75-year-old man died in St George Hospital, and a 80-year-old woman died in Gosford Hospital yesterday.
Thirty-three people in NSW have died from coronavirus.
A total of three people died in NSW from coronavirus in the 24 hours to 8:00pm yesterday.
As well as the fatalities at the two hospitals, a 92-year-old resident at the Newmarch House nursing home in Western Sydney died.
She was the third death at the facility where there has been a cluster of COVID-19 cases after an employee worked six shifts despite having mild symptoms of the virus.
There were just five new coronavirus cases in NSW yesterday, taking the state's total to 2,974.
It was the lowest number of new infections since four were recorded in the 24 hours to 8:00pm on March 10.
